Details about Simandhar Bhagwan
Answer
Simandhar Bhagwan is a highly revered Tirthankar in Jain Dharma, presently believed to be residing in Mahavideh Kshetra in the Jain cosmic universe. He is not one of the 24 Tirthankars of our Bharata Kshetra, but a presently active Tirthankar in another region where spiritual liberation is still possible.Explanation
In Jain cosmology, the universe is divided into many regions. In Mahavideh Kshetra, Tirthankars continue to appear, preach Dharma, and guide living beings toward liberation.Simandhar Bhagwan is especially important because:
- He is a living Tirthankar in Jain belief.
- He is considered accessible through deep devotion, purity of mind, and spiritual practice.
- He represents hope, guidance, and the eternal presence of Dharma beyond our visible world.
Devotees often remember him with great reverence and pray for spiritual progress, inner purity, and liberation.
